Enid & Pugsley – Available for Adoption
Meet Enid & Pugsley: two of the most rambunctious, comedic and snuggly kittens around!
Enid & Pugsley are littermates who will always find each other before a nap, and who love to chase each other all over the apartment! These kittens have energy to burn, and their favorite things to do include climbing tall cat trees, chasing toy springs, and bugging their feline foster siblings.
Pugsley is the snugglier of the bunch. He’s also the more energetic and bigger of the two. He loves to jump on all surfaces (even the one's he's not supposed to), try new cat foods and treats, and play with wand toys. He’s pretty mischievous and is always eager to explore! But when Pugsley’s energy runs out, he beelines for his foster mom and cuddles right up. He’s always underfoot, and even sits by his foster mom as she applies makeup.
Enid is the more serious and intellectual of the two! She’s more cautious with her affections, but once she gets to know you, she’ll flop over and show you her belly. She’s an expert athlete: catapulting in the air as her foster dad plays with wand toys, successfully playing fetch, and chasing after her brother. Like Pugsley, as soon as she’s tired, Enid looks for a human or cat to cuddle with, and promptly passes out.
These two absolutely adore other cats, and took no time to ingratiate themselves with their foster feline siblings. While both love to be the center of attention, they also respond well to redirection.
Pugsley & Enid’s ideal home is with people who know how energetic and chaotic kittens can be, and who have a lot of time and love to dedicate to these superstars. These kittens are quick to love and are hysterical to watch! They love being around humans and other cats, and want to spend as much time socializing as possible. Since being at their foster, they’ve attended a Super Bowl party, met a baby, successfully ridden in several long car rides, and have fallen in love with their foster grandparents in the burbs.
Because these two are so confident and socialized, they’d be great in a home with other cats, and would probably do well with children and dogs! The world is their oyster, and they’re ready to fill a home with joy and laughter!
Enid & Pugsley are 4 months old, fixed, and up-to-date on all their shots. If you are interested in meeting them, contact Boston's Forgotten Felines on Facebook or at catadoptions@bostonsforgottenfelines.org
